1. Synergistic effects in which two or more hormones act together to produce an effect that is greater than the sum of their separate effects. 2. Permissive effects in which one hormone enhances the target organ's response to a second hormone that is secreted later. 3. Antagonistic effects in which one hormone opposes the action of another. For example, insulin lowers blood glucose level and glucagon raises it.

The process by which two hormones exert opposite effects is known as antagonism. Antagonism occurs when one hormone inhibits the actions of another hormone by competing for the same receptors or signaling pathways within the body. This leads to a counterbalancing effect that helps maintain homeostasis.
